  1. 1 Whether the trial court failed to account for the period spent in custody prior to sentencing as required by Section 333(2) of the Criminal Procedure Act

Ratio Decidendi

The trial court expressly stated it considered the period spent in custody and mitigation before sentencing; therefore, the application for revision is not merited.
